The Orioles host the Philadelphia Phillies in today's exhibition game at Ed Smith Stadium. Left-hander Brian Matusz will start for the Orioles against right-hander Kyle Kendrick.
First baseman Michael Aubrey said this morning that his strained right groin is still "a little sore and tight" and that he'll need a few days to get back on the field.
"It's extremely frustrating,'' he said. "I'm trying to put myself in a good position and you can't do that if you're not playing."
The O's have firmed up Tuesday's seven-inning intrasquad game, which will start at 10:15 a.m. and will be started by Kevin Millwood and Jim Johnson.
The club hosted about 40 developmently disabled kids from The Challenger League after Saturday's "B" game. Five players from the Orioles "B" lineup stayed around after the game to lead the kids through a one-inning game in which everyone got one at-bat and a chance to play in the field.
